http://www.newsday.co.tt/news/0,228084.html The bloodshed continued Thursday night when at half past eight, Clint Julien, a 36-year-old Arima roadside preacher was stabbed to death during a fight over religion. Police said that Julien of Marie Avenue, Maturita was among five members of the Jehovah’s Witness faith who were preaching at the side of the road near Golden Grove Junction in Arouca. Two men, of a different faith, did not like the preaching and an argument arose.
